I have a Noob question. Are air domes used with autopot systems or can you use an air dome by itself and hand water?
I bought them with my Autopots... however I don't use my Autopots. I have these plants in 3quart pots. I have an Airdome in one and I am handwatering. However, using an Airdome in such a small pot is an advanced technique. I Don't suggest it without an Automated system. I prefer a drip stake system feeding 6x per day. But for this little experiment, I will hand water. These plants I water 2x per day now. Never to run off yet.
 
Well it is official, Day 4 with Airdome on. The smaller plant is now taller! Told ya! It is getting taller, the other one is thicker. But the Airdomes make plants stretch more. Wait and see, it will be taller and also flower faster. But I believe the Domes become obsolete near the tail end of flower. The roots don't need the extra air at that point in the plants life. So I have been turning them off the last 2 weeks of the plants life.

How do you recommend turning on autopots and airdomes? Both at the same day? Day before hand watering? Or when pots are dry?
Not too much N, my camera phone just blows so it looks darker. With your giant Autopots I suggest turning on the Airdomes a week before you turn on the Autopots. One thing of the reasons your plants take longer and struggle at times is because of too much moisture in a big pot without roots. Personally I would handwater with Airdomes on around day 14 and handwater lightly from the top for 5-7 days before flooding the bottom with Autopots. Your root system will do much better, and growth will be much faster. BTW, you can always put your air pump on a timer of you have any concerns.
